4. Specifications

4.1 System Parameters (Model: COMBO-SPRAY-9L-18S)

ItemParameter
ModelCOMBO-SPRAY-9L-18S
ConfigurationSPR 4517 380KV + HW 5116
Dimensions (L*W*H)75mm * 278.3mm * 97.8mm
Weight495g
Compatible Voltage12S-18S (DC24-81V) Li-Po
Rated Flow5 L/min
Maximum Flow9 L/min
Continuous Current7A
Instantaneous Current10A
MAX Power500W (54V)
Rated Power350W
Control ModePWM/CAN
Atomized Particle Size35-500μm
Spray Amplitude (single nozzle)4-12m
Water Inlet Outer Diameter10.8mm (recommended to use soft tube with inner diameter < 9mm)
Power Cord Length71cm

4.2 ESC Parameters

ItemParameter
ESC ModelHW5116_YT1_V1.2
Throttle Travel1050-1950 µs
Communication MethodCAN
Control ModePWM/CAN
Instantaneous Protection Current100A
Motor SizeD44
ColorBlue

4.3 Environmental Adaptability

ItemParameter
NSS Salt Spray Test72 hours
Protection LevelIPX6 (Resistant to high-pressure water jets)
Operating Temperature Range0°C to 50°C
Operating Humidity Range5% to 95% RH
Storage Temperature Range-10°C to 50°C
Storage Humidity Range≤85% RH

5. Setup and Installation

5.1 Mounting the Nozzle

  1. Identify the mounting point on your agricultural drone or spray system. The nozzle features a secure mounting mechanism.
  2. Align the nozzle's mounting bracket with the drone arm or designated attachment area.
  3. Use the provided screws and nuts to firmly attach the nozzle. Ensure it is stable and does not wobble.
  4. Utilize the 'LOCK/UNLOCK PRESS' mechanism (refer to Figure 4) to secure the nozzle in place after mounting. Press to lock, and rotate to unlock for removal.

5.2 Water Inlet Connection

  1. Connect a soft tube to the water inlet of the nozzle. The water inlet has an outer diameter of 10.8mm.
  2. It is recommended to use a soft tube with an inner diameter of less than 9mm for a secure fit and optimal flow.
  3. Ensure the connection is tight and leak-free to prevent loss of liquid and potential damage.

5.3 Electrical Connections

The nozzle uses an integrated power and signal cable. Refer to the pin definition table below for proper wiring:

PinColorFunction
1RedPower +
2PurpleOil Pump IS
3GreenCAN-H
4BlueCAN-L
5BlackGND

Ensure correct polarity and secure connections to your drone's flight controller or power distribution board. The system supports PWM/CAN control modes.

7. Maintenance

Regular maintenance ensures the longevity and performance of your Hobbywing centrifugal nozzle.

  • Cleaning: After each use, especially when spraying chemicals, flush the nozzle with clean water to prevent clogging and corrosion.
  • Inspection: Periodically inspect the nozzle for any signs of wear, damage, or blockages. Check the spray disc (Figure 2) for debris.
  • Seals: Ensure all O-rings and seals are intact and properly seated to maintain the IPX6 protection level. Replace if worn or damaged.
  • Storage: Store the nozzle in a clean, dry place away from direct sunlight and extreme temperatures.

8. Troubleshooting

8.1 Common Issues and Solutions

ProblemPossible CauseSolution
No spray or weak sprayClogged nozzle, insufficient water supply, power issueClean the nozzle, check water pump and tank, verify power connections.
Inconsistent spray patternPartial clog, damaged spray discClean the nozzle thoroughly, inspect and replace spray disc if damaged.
No power to the nozzleLoose electrical connection, faulty ESC/motor, battery issueCheck all wiring (refer to Section 5.3), test battery voltage, consult Hobbywing support if ESC/motor is suspected.
Water leakageLoose hose connection, damaged O-ring/sealTighten hose clamps, inspect and replace O-rings/seals.

9. User Tips

  • Compatibility: Always verify the compatibility of this nozzle system with your specific drone model (e.g., Boying Paladin 4) and flight controller before purchase and installation.
  • Battery Voltage: The system is designed to operate with 12S to 18S Li-Po batteries. Ensure your battery setup falls within this range for proper function.
  • Water Tube Size: For the water inlet, using a soft tube with an inner diameter slightly smaller than 9mm (e.g., 8mm) can provide a more secure and leak-proof connection to the 10.8mm outer diameter inlet.
